Effect of foliar sprays of Ethrel on growth of soybean

International Journal of Chemical Studies · 2018 · Vol. 6(5) · pp. 2253–2255

Abstract

The present study examined the effectiveness of foliar sprays of ethrel on growth and yield of soybean (Glycine max). A field experiment was conducted at an experimental farm of Botany section, College of Agriculture, Nagpur by growing soybean during the kharif season in the crop area spanning from July 2013 – November 2013, using randomized block design. The effectiveness of foliar sprays of ethrel was studied as control (water spray) and with 5 different levels of ethrel (100, 150, 200, 250 and 300 ppm). Soybean plants were sprayed two times at 15 day intervals at 30 and 45 DAS with different concentrations of ethrel. Recorded data showed that all morpho-physiological parameters including plant height, number of branches, leaf area, dry matter production, RGR and NAR as well as yield ha-1 of soybean plants showed positive and significant responses with the foliar application of 150 ppm ethrel followed by 100 ppm ethrel when compared with control.
